Join us! Job Description: Primary responsibility is to prepare/review documentation in accordance with bank policies and procedures. Independently perform research and discuss loans with line partners with confidence and knowledge. Independently works with a range in complexity of documentation.

Interfaces with company vendors, legal counsel and line partners to ensure world-class documentation accuracy. Maintain primary responsibility for accuracy of documentation, timely delivery of documents and elimination of controllable re-works.

In all measurable categories maintains an acceptable level of errors. Assist Market Leader in the facilitation of team meetings, training and quality review when necessary Responsibilities: Review loan documentation in compliance with bank policies and procedures.

Independently research and discuss loan details with line partners, demonstrating confidence and subject matter expertise. Loan bookings of varying complexity and ensure world-class accuracy. Maintain responsibility for input loan bookings into SOR (System of Record) and minimize controllable rework.

Collaborate with Client Managers, Credit and Portfolio Officers, agency management, legal counsel, and internal support units to ensure seamless transaction execution Minimum Qualifications: Minimum 2 years’ experience with commercial and/or consumer loan documentation review.

Familiarity with GFS and Loan IQ systems. Strong written and verbal communication skills. Excellent organizational and multitasking abilities. Detail-oriented with a high level of accuracy. Proficient in Microsoft Word and Excel. Ability to work effectively in a team environment, including with remote teammates
